Targeting fusion oncoproteins in childhood cancers: Challenges and future opportunities for developing therapeutics
Cet article décrit les principaux enseignements tirés des principales plateformes et technologies pouvant être utilisées pour améliorer le développement de thérapies moléculaires ciblant les oncoprotéines de fusion dans les cancers pédiatriques puis présente les avancées en matière de chimie thérapeutique et de biologie chimique offrant de nouvelles perspectives de développement
Fusion oncoproteins are associated with childhood cancers and have proven challenging to target, aside from those that include kinases. As part of its efforts for targeting childhood cancers, the National Cancer Institute recently conducted a series on ‘Novel Chemical Approaches for Targeting Fusion Oncoproteins’. Key learnings on leading platforms and technologies which can be utilized to advance the development of molecular therapeutics that target fusion oncoproteins in childhood cancers are described. Recent breakthroughs in medicinal chemistry and chemical biology provide new ground and creative strategies to exploit for the development of targeted agents for improving outcomes against these recalcitrant cancers.
